County figures come from the US Census Bureau's American Community Survey, 5-year pooled estimates, so the 2023 vintage covers 2019 through 2023. The Census category is 'mining, quarrying, and oil and gas extraction', which is broader than MSHA jurisdiction and includes oil and gas workers no mine employs. These figures describe the surrounding county, not this mine, and are not a factor in any specific incident.
